HESQ Advisor Derry / Londonderry £OpentoChatting Company Vehicle The Health and Safety Officer is responsible for promoting and ensuring health and safety of the workers, in the workplace, environment and the public. General duties include: Creating and implementing current health and safety policies. Investigating accidents and incidents. Conducting and Reviewing Risk Assessments and Method Statements. Co-ordinate staff training and toolbox talks. Ensuring compliance with HSEQ policies, regulations and legislation. Demonstrating Safe Systems of Work and Safe Operational Procedures. Conducting Site Inspections and audits with photographic evidence and reports. Ensure compliance of IMS. Liaise with clients, H&S representatives and workers on HSEQ matters, attend meetings and provide reports. Essential Required: NEBOSH Qualification. CSR or equivalent card. Excellent IT and PC skills (Excel, Word, PowerPoint, Outlook). Valid Driving Licence. Excellent communication skills. Interested in hearing more? How to prepare for a job interview at Reactive Recruitment

Showcase Your NEBOSH Knowledge

Make sure to highlight your NEBOSH qualification during the interview. Be prepared to discuss specific health and safety policies you've implemented or reviewed in the past, as this will demonstrate your expertise and understanding of the role.

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ions

Expect questions that ask how you would handle specific health and safety incidents or challenges. Think of examples from your previous experience where you successfully managed risks or conducted effective training sessions.

Demonstrate Strong Communication Skills

Since excellent communication is essential for this role, practice articulating your thoughts clearly and confidently. Be ready to explain complex HSEQ concepts in a way that is easy to understand for clients and colleagues alike.

Familiarize Yourself with Relevant Legislation

Brush up on current health and safety regulations and legislation relevant to the industry. Being knowledgeable about compliance requirements will show that you are proactive and serious about ensuring workplace safety.
